Transaction 72ff662956948cbd769b46ff1d6daf0598579142fb6d345c22c80e9a0eaca1af

32 Input
2 Outputs
  • 72ff662956948cbd769b46ff1d6daf0598579142fb6d345c22c80e9a0eaca1af:0
  • value  19000000
    address  37LeAcU2CzSpfEMHyXHf3hydGPBCs18cL3
  • 72ff662956948cbd769b46ff1d6daf0598579142fb6d345c22c80e9a0eaca1af:1
  • value  987070
    address  3FV4UeXfXG37jVWtHyNnuVfTjtqt4mss26